#7cbf94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7cbf94 is composed of 48.6% red, 74.9%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.5%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 141.5 degrees, a saturation of 34.4% and a lightness of 61.8%. #7cbf94 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ffff with #007f29.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#7cbf94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f3f9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7cbf94
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9aa19d is the less saturated color, while #40fb83 is the most saturated one.
